was great... now it's good!!. i always liked thisplaceas a drinking place, very lively always busy and generally happening. to top it off the food was really great.. every thing from the side st steak to the philly was certainly at the higher end and i considered it to be some of the best casual dining in midtown!!
then tragedgy struck and a fire gutted the place.. and sadly it had to close for about 6 months, which at the time you had to feel that something great would come out of the deal for the owners as theplacecould have done with an upgrade and refit!! that is surely what you have got, a much cleaner, way more brighter and a new look was born. unfortunately in my opinion it has lost a lot of the old charm in the process. the most dramatic and drastic change is the crowd... a lot younger and definately a lot louder!!! the patio is still great and in my opinion one of if not the best in midtown!!
now on to the food...well as the title explains it also has lost some of it's appeal.. the bread for the sandwiches is a complete let down, whereas it used to be a nice french roll has been replaced with something similar to what you buy pre-packaged in schnucks which does not do the sandwiches justice!! the consistency is way off.. sometimes good and sometimes average!!
they do have great specials during the week for a couple and mosty definately value for money!!
a lot of staff changes... some good and one or two really bad, where i will actually leave!!!
as always would i go back... most definately in the warm months for their patio... i have been back several times since the re-open, but instead of my main stop it is now my starting or ending point.
would i eat again... absolutely but not as frequently and definately a lot more selectively!!!

just not the same.... the side street grill has been my favorite stomping ground for the past 2-3 years. the martinis, although pricey, cannot be beat for sheer flavor and alcohol content! you wouldn't expect the food to be as decent as it would be in a bar, but it's excellent - i'm craving it right now!

that said, the grill recently reopened after a fire earlier this year, and the atmosphere has completely changed. what used to be a very low-key, dark and relaxed environment has become a much brighter and louder place. my friends and i hit it up last week and we couldn't even hear each other talking across the table. perhaps it was the acoustics of the new building or the amount of people inside, but it was never this loud in the old building.

in addition to the noise, one of the bartenders was quite rude to us. while not yet published for the new place, the grill had a shooter menu before it burned down, and my friend asked for one of the drinks that we remembered being on that menu. the waitress said it would be no problem, and it was brought to us soon after. the drink tasted like watery coke and was nothing like what we remembered. we flagged the waitress back over and asked for it to be remade. second try, still watery, and we just sent it back for good.

then - and this is what made us mad - the bartender came over unprompted, telling us that she made the drink the way it's supposed to be. we informed her that no, it's never tasted like that here, and we really just didn't care to try it anymore if it was going to be prepared like that. she got huffy and said "well, what would you like?" i'd never seen this woman before, and really didn't appreciate her telling a bunch of regulars what her crappy drink was supposed to taste like.

the food cannot be beaten, and the drinks (most of them!) are impeccable. the grill itself just isn't the old relaxingplacei remember.

good food and good martinis. i was lucky enough to get a table at side street two days after they reopened after a devastating fire destroyed the original building. the food is simple but well done. too many restaurants complicate burgers and salads. side street sticks to quality ingredients and great seasoning.

my waiter was outstanding (a slim dark haired fellow). the crowd was divers and fun.

the only drawback is that there's noplaceto escape the smoke. this is a bar's bar. , i'd love go back more but my allergies only allow for so much smoke.

other than that, it was a great experience. note: the extensive list of martinis comes in two sizes. the smaller size lets you try more of the fun flavors.
